How We Work
1
Emergency Contact
Your urgent call initiates our rapid response. We gather critical information, assess the water damage over the phone, and dispatch a certified team to your Sugar Land location immediately to prevent further damage.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to accurately map the extent of water intrusion. This detailed inspection informs our comprehensive drying plan and prepares for water extraction.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ered pumps and industrial-grade extractors remove standing water. We then strategically place dehumidifiers and air movers to thoroughly dry affected areas, preventing mold growth and preparing for restoration.
4
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ated materials are safely removed. We apply antimicrobial treatments to sanitize all surfaces, ensuring a clean and healthy environment. This step ensures readiness for structural repairs and reconstruction.
5
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Our skilled craftsmen repair or replace damaged building materials, rest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. A final walkthrough ensures your complete satisfaction with our work and the restored space.

Clogged Drain Water Removal Cost In Texas City, TX

The cost of Clogged Drain Water Removal var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Texas City, TX.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an that meets your specific need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 - $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of drying required.
Restoration and re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required for restoration.
Equipment rental and usage $500 - $2,000 The type and duration of equipment rental.
Travel and labor costs $500 - $2,000 The distance to the job site and the number of technicians required.
Materials and supplies $500 - $2,000 The type and quantity of materials required for restoration.

Q: Can I prevent clogged drains?

A: Yes, regular maintenance can help prevent clogged drains. Use a drain screen or filter to catch hair and debris, and consider using a drain cleaner to keep your pipes clear.
